Transaction 75126073a26f62bd52f22221b7c4b74af22af6f8d25f77dcb66a6b5d3260f279

1 Input
2 Outputs
  • 75126073a26f62bd52f22221b7c4b74af22af6f8d25f77dcb66a6b5d3260f279:0
  • value  67014
    address  3AAEfNA1nzFaGr2FZDVEpfDbCUt72sBtj7
  • 75126073a26f62bd52f22221b7c4b74af22af6f8d25f77dcb66a6b5d3260f279:1
  • value  12200
    address  bc1qaqttt38v0vsyl3rq06ccpumuc5jxxxkmx8mnuw